WhatsApp scam targets users with virus to steal their details
WhatsApp users, be warned - a new scam is trying to infect your smartphone with a nasty virus.
'Secret' messages offering an exclusive version of the messenger called WhatsApp Gold are being sent to users of the instant messaging app on Android devices. Users are being told that WhatsApp Gold has enhanced features used by celebrities - but it is just an attempt to install malware onto your phone.
